There Is Only Now - Life often feels like a relentless race—planning for the future, dwelling on the past, always reaching for something beyond the present moment. But the truth is, the only time that truly exists is now. Everything else is a mental construct. The Illusion of Time We measure our lives in years, months, and minutes, yet none of these truly define our experience. The past is a collection of memories, colored by perception and shaped by emotion. The future is merely an expectation, uncertain and subject to change. Despite this, we spend much of our time trapped between regrets and anxieties, missing the only moment that is real—the present. Why We Resist the Present Being fully present can be uncomfortable. It requires surrendering control, letting go of what was, and accepting what is. People often escape into distractions, whether through work, entertainment, or constant planning, because facing the present means facing themselves. It means acknowledging emotions, uncertainties, and the raw reality of existence. Yet, resisting the present does not change it. Life continues, and every moment spent elsewhere is a moment lost. The Power of Now Living in the present does not mean neglecting responsibilities or failing to prepare for what’s ahead. It means recognizing that every action, every decision, and every experience happens now. It means being fully engaged in conversations, appreciating small details, and embracing the unfolding of life without constantly reaching for what’s next. When you fully inhabit the present, life becomes richer. The simple act of breathing, the warmth of the sun, the rhythm of footsteps—all of these hold meaning when you slow down enough to notice. How to Live in the Present Let Go of the Past – Acknowledge it, learn from it, but do not let it dictate your present. What happened is unchangeable; what you do now is within your control. Stop Chasing the Future – Planning is valuable, but obsessing over outcomes creates stress. Take action now, but remain flexible to life’s unpredictability. Engage Fully – Whether it’s a conversation, a meal, or a quiet moment alone, be there completely. Avoid distractions and focus on what’s happening right now. Practice Awareness – Meditation, deep breathing, and mindfulness exercises help train the mind to stay in the present. Even simple acts like paying attention to your surroundings can ground you in the now. Accept Imperfection – Life is not a controlled sequence of events. The unexpected will happen. Rather than resisting, embrace the moment as it is. Conclusion There is only now. The past has passed, and the future is unwritten. Life is happening in this very moment, and the only way to truly live it is to be here for it.

Introduction

In the complex web of human relationships, there is an intriguing phenomenon that often goes unnoticed: people tend to be drawn to individuals who exhibit a degree of predictability in their behavior. While it may seem counterintuitive in a world that celebrates uniqueness and spontaneity, the reality is that many individuals find comfort and security in knowing what to expect from those around them. In this article, we explore the psychology behind this preference for predictability and why people are naturally inclined to like those who are somewhat predictable.

The Comfort of Predictability

Predictability offers a sense of stability and security in an otherwise uncertain world. Humans have evolved to seek safety and reduce the perceived threats in their environment, and predictability plays a significant role in achieving this goal. When people can anticipate how someone will behave in various situations, it reduces anxiety and allows for smoother interactions.

  1. Trust and Reliability

One of the key reasons people are drawn to predictability is the establishment of trust and reliability. When individuals consistently act in a manner aligned with their values and intentions, it builds trust among their peers. Trust is a foundation upon which strong relationships are built, and predictability enhances this process by allowing others to rely on a person’s consistent behavior.

  1. Reduced Uncertainty

Uncertainty can be unsettling, and humans naturally seek to minimize it. When someone is somewhat predictable, it reduces the uncertainty associated with their actions and decisions. This predictability provides a sense of control and allows people to plan and adapt more effectively in social situations.

  1. Emotional Comfort

Predictability also offers emotional comfort. Knowing how someone will react in certain situations allows individuals to better navigate their own emotions. When you understand how a friend or partner will respond to a particular situation, it can be easier to express yourself and share your thoughts and feelings.

  1. Cognitive Ease

Cognitive ease is another factor that makes predictability attractive. When interactions with predictable individuals require less mental effort, it frees up cognitive resources for other tasks and decision-making. This can lead to more enjoyable and less draining social interactions.

The Balance of Predictability

While predictability has its advantages, it’s important to recognize that excessive predictability can be stifling and uninteresting. People also value novelty and excitement in their relationships. Striking the right balance between predictability and unpredictability is key to maintaining engaging and fulfilling connections.

  1. Maintaining Individuality

It’s essential to avoid becoming overly predictable to the point of losing one’s individuality. Embracing personal growth, trying new things, and occasionally stepping outside one’s comfort zone can add depth and excitement to relationships.

  1. Adaptability

Being predictably adaptable can be an attractive trait. This means being consistent in core values and principles while remaining flexible and open to new experiences and perspectives. It allows individuals to grow together while maintaining the stability that predictability offers.

  1. Communication

Clear communication is vital for balancing predictability and unpredictability. Discussing expectations and boundaries within a relationship can help both parties feel comfortable and secure while allowing room for surprises and spontaneity.

Conclusion

In a world filled with unpredictability, the appeal of people who are somewhat predictable becomes evident. Predictability offers a sense of comfort, trust, and emotional security that many individuals find valuable in their relationships. However, it’s essential to strike a balance between predictability and unpredictability to maintain engaging and fulfilling connections. By understanding and appreciating the role of predictability in human interactions, we can cultivate more meaningful and stable relationships in our lives.
